000 ABNT20 KNHC 252319 TWOAT Tropical Weather Outlook NWS National Hurricane Center Miami FL 800 PM EDT Mon Sep 25 2023 For the North Atlantic...Caribbean Sea and the Gulf of Mexico: Active Systems: The National Hurricane Center is issuing advisories on Tropical Storm Philippe, located over the central tropical Atlantic. Eastern Tropical Atlantic (AL91): Showers and thunderstorms have increased in association with a tropical wave located several hundred miles west-southwest of the Cabo Verde Islands. Environmental conditions are forecast to be conducive for additional development, and a tropical depression is expected to form in 2-3 days as the system moves west-northwestward across the central tropical Atlantic. * Formation chance through 48 hours...medium...60 percent. * Formation chance through 7 days...high...90 percent. $$ Forecaster Papin/Blake
